Taylor, and Drew Waters tentatively penciled into the starting jobs. Taylor is another player who drew some calls at the trade deadline, and could be moved to a team in need of defensive help if the Royals want to use Waters in center field instead of a corner spot. After being acquired from the Braves in July, Waters change of scenery seemed to take, as he hit well at both the Triple-A level and in his first 109 plate appearances in the majors.
